Understanding the Tape Coating Process

The tape coating process involves applying a specific substance, such as adhesives, inks, or coatings, onto the substrate material, typically a tape. This method is critical in various industries, including electronics, automotive, and packaging.

Common Challenges in Tape Coating Processes

  1. Inconsistent Coatings: Variability in coating thickness can lead to product failure.
  2. Material Waste: Excess coating material can result in higher costs and environmental issues.
  3. Equipment Downtime: Frequent machine malfunctions can disrupt production schedules.
  4. Quality Control Issues: Lacking proper quality control measures can result in subpar products.

Strategies for Tape Coating Process Optimization

To tackle the challenges listed above, integrating the following strategies can lead to substantial improvements in your tape coating operations.

Implementing Advanced Coating Technologies

Utilizing modern coating technologies such as:

  • Roll-to-Roll Coating: Allows for continuous processing, reducing waste.
  • Slot Die Coating: Provides uniform layers of coatings, minimizing variations in thickness.
  • Spray Coating: Effective for applying adhesive in complex patterns.

Regular Equipment Maintenance

Preventive maintenance is key to minimizing downtime. Consider the following actions:

  • Schedule routine inspections of coating machines.
  • Ensure all parts are lubricated and functioning correctly.
  • Replace worn-out components proactively.

Control Systems and Monitoring

Investing in automated control systems can improve monitoring and adjustments in real-time. Benefits include:

  • Enhanced control over coating thickness.
  • Immediate feedback on production inconsistencies.
  • Data analytics to identify trends and issues for further optimization.

Table: Key Metrics for Efficiency Improvement

MetricCurrent PerformanceTarget PerformanceImprovement Strategy
Coating Thickness Variability± 10 microns± 2 micronsImplement slot die coating
Material Waste15%5%Adopt roll-to-roll coating
Machine Downtime20 hours/month5 hours/monthEnhanced preventive maintenance
Quality Reject Rate8%2%In-line inspections and training
